> yesterday I switched my VDR from v1.4.1 to v1.6.0 on a debian system.
> I'm running two DVB-S cards (Nexus FF and Nova). The update was
> without any problem.
>
> But today I found a problem:
> When recording on one program I can view at the same time just the
> channels of the same bouquet but no other ones (two cards!!).  But
> recording simultaniously on two different bouquets works.
>
> With v1.4.1 there was no problem in recording one channel and
> switching to all other channels.
>
> I didn't find any hint on the mailinglist or vdr-portal about this
> problem. Is there any other having the same problem?
>
> Are there any hints how to solve this problem?
